My wife has a 01 Hyndia sante fe 4x4 we were coming home from work the other day, I had the cruise set at 70mph and all of a sudden it acted like it went in to nutreul. Didnt make a noise didnt bang or anything just went out of gear. Checked all the fluids the looked clean and did not smell burnt, nothing broke or hanging underneath the car. The only gear it will go in is park. It will not shift when its in 4x4 either. Mech said over the phone that it was the tranny and it would run $1350. What do yall think?

why don't you slide underneath the truck and pull the drain plug to inspect the oil. Make sure the oil is not burnt and there is no metal on the magnet.
I doubt you have internal gear or bearing failure since there was not odd noise.

if this is the same tranny im thinking about, all the clutches will be fine but, the front pump will be destroyed due to a snap ring that holds a clutch pack in, the ring breaks and gets chewed up into the front pump breaking the gear and trashing the TC.
